And Woona is the only married woman out of the four. Ara is a mute hair stylist who spends her free time obsessing over Taein, a fictional K-pop singer. Miho is an orphan who has become an artist and now has a chaebol boyfriend. Kyuri is a stunning room salon girl who obtains her beauty through plastic surgery. The storyline spins deftly through four first-person perspectives that slowly fold together. From overarching beauty standards and cutthroat pressure among social classes to broken family relationships, the novel fleshes out the ramifications of these issues through the narration of its main female protagonists. In her debut novel, releasing April 21, former CNN reporter Frances Cha tackles topical social issues that women in South Korea struggle to overcome. Detailed perspectives of the world around the building come from the voices of the five women it houses, in the riveting slice-of-life tale, “ If I Had Your Face.” Sitting on the same road with a perfect view of all the sordid dealings is a gray, cheaply built, four-story officetel. In the busiest part of Seoul, South Korea lies a street buzzing with drunk men, who are exploring the abundance of bars that the area has to offer.
